Heritage
A house, in its own words
Beso Beach Perfumes emerged from a creative partnership between Rafa Viar and Angie López, two individuals whose backgrounds converged around a shared vision for fragrance. Viar brought reportedly three decades of entrepreneurial experience to the venture, while the collaboration extended into the fragrance world through an association with Carner Barcelona. The brand made its industry debut at Esxence 2019, a prominent Italian fragrance exhibition that served as the first public introduction to the perfume community. The initial fragrance collection launched in 2018, with Beso Canalla, Beso Negro, and Bendito Beso representing the founding expressions. Each subsequent year saw new additions to the line, including Beso Pasión (2020), Beso Feliz (2022), and Beso de Luna (2023). The brand reportedly operates from an ethos centered on Mediterranean coastal culture, with particular emphasis on the lifestyle and atmosphere associated with Ibiza, widely recognized as a center for creative expression and resort culture in Europe. The collaboration with Carner Barcelona, an established Spanish fragrance house known for artisan perfumery, provided the technical foundation and industry credibility for the newer brand's entrance into the niche fragrance market.
The creative direction of Beso Beach Perfumes centers on translating the intangible essence of beach living into olfactory form. Rather than simply recreating marine or tropical note combinations, the brand reportedly seeks to capture the emotional atmosphere of coastal resort culture: the languor of afternoon sun, the social energy of beach gatherings, and the sensory palette of Mediterranean summers. The naming convention reflects this approach, using Spanish terms like Beso (kiss), Dorado (golden), and Fuego (fire) to establish an immediate cultural context for each fragrance. The brand maintains that each scent should function as a wearable memory of beach experiences, allowing wearers to carry coastal atmosphere beyond geographical location. The philosophy reportedly emphasizes class and sophistication within the resort-inspired genre, distinguishing the collection from purely casual or seasonal fragrance lines. This approach positions Beso Beach as a bridge between casual beach reference and genuine perfumery craft, appealing to consumers who appreciate both accessible scent storytelling and the quality standards of niche fragrance.
